Body parts used for ancient Egyptian artworks traced to surprising source

So, it turns out that ancient Egyptians were quite resourceful when it came to creating their artworks! They used body parts from a variety of animals, including donkeys and antelopes, along with plant materials. This research highlights that the ingredients for their art came from a broader range of species than we ever imagined.
